A length of exceptionally sharp metal with a handle, used for centuries as the go-to killing device for the human race. It's dead simple: you stick the pointy end in the thing you want to die. Or you could always slash them with the equally sharp sides. That works too.
A tree is a perennial woody plant. Trees are often used in games as a natural wall, providing a barrier as well as cover. Many games also use them to make their environments looks more natural and attractive.
Even though water in games tends to bring about death, we all still hold it near and dear to us. After all, the human body is comprised mostly of it.
Considered one of the most frequent and controversial implements of destruction in video games and real life, guns are devices that fire projectiles with explosive force.
Cars go places. Hopefully fast.
Doors are a common object in most video games, as well as the keys and objects needed to open them. From role playing to shooters, doors are an important component of many games.
Used to open doors, or anything else that is locked. In any game where the player has an inventory, it's a safe bet that a key will appear at some point.
Some games have readable books. Come and quench your thirst for knowledge.
Coins have long been used in video games as both a form of currency and as a means of accruing points.
Plants bearing petals that are often fragrant and vibrantly colored.
An article of clothing that rests on top of one's head.
A barrel is a hollow cylindrical container, traditionally made of wood staves and bound with iron hoops. In video games, it is used in many ways to fill up a level or even be used in one. They also may explode. Use caution when around barrels.
Whether it's worn for protection or style, helmets appear in various game genres.
A flat surface that is often used to place objects upon - most commonly, food.
The premier choice in your defensive needs. A great companion for any one handed sword, which in addition to blocking can be used for advanced maneuvers like Shield Bashes.
Crates sometimes contain things!
A garment made for covering the hand.
The axe is a tool used for many activities. Its uses include cutting wood, knocking down doors in emergencies, and rending your enemies limb from limb without mercy or regret.
A bomb is an explosive device.
A knife is a commonly seen object in video games. Usually used for close quarters combat, or as a cutting tool.
A ladder is used to gain access to higher or lower ground. Also used as a weapon in most wrestling games.
Whether it's translucent, transparent, opaque, glass, plastic, or some other material the bottle can be your best friend, or your worst enemy. Sometimes filled with liquor, or maybe an extra supply of lantern oil.
A box containing treasure usually in the form of gold or valuable items.
A kind of protective clothing.
Whether they're tedious and spiral or short and quick, staircases appear in many games.
A furniture that provides a place to sleep. In video games, often used to regain health, skip time and *ahem* other activities...
Rocks are the hard objects found randomly scattered across the ground all over the Earth's surface. They're not good for much more than smashing stuff or being made into other things. Handily crushes Scissors but cannot defeat the mighty Paper.
A framework built into a wall or roof to let in light or air.
A sculpted representation of a person or object, generally in butter or stone.
A corded length of fibers that has many uses.
